Product details

Overview

AD9220ARS-REEL from Analog Devices is a monolithic 12-bit analog-to-digital converter with 10.0 MSPS sampling rate, 70 dB SINAD, and 88 dB SFDR, operating on a single 5 V analog supply and 2.7–5.25 V digital supply. It integrates a low-noise sample-and-hold amplifier, programmable internal voltage reference (1 V or 2.5 V), and straight-binary output logic. It is used in high-speed data acquisition systems requiring precise dc linearity and wideband ac performance.

Technical Context

The AD9220ARS-REEL employs a four-stage differential pipelined architecture with digital error correction logic, enabling guaranteed 12-bit no-missing-codes operation across –40°C to +85°C. Its sample-and-hold amplifier supports both single-ended and differential inputs with configurable common-mode level (via CML pin) and flexible input spans (2 V or 5 V p-p).

It uses edge-sensitive clocking: sampling occurs on the rising edge of CLK, while the SHA tracks during the low phase and holds during the high phase. Pipeline latency is fixed at three clock cycles, and the out-of-range (OTR) signal provides overflow detection synchronized to the MSB for unambiguous over/underflow identification.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Resolution12-bit guaranteed, with no missing codes over full temperature range - ensures full 4096-code fidelity in precision measurement systems.
Max Conversion Rate10.0 MSPS - enables digitization of signals up to 5 MHz Nyquist bandwidth in undersampled applications.
SINAD / ENOB70 dB / 11.3 bits at 100 kHz input - supports high-fidelity baseband sampling in medical imaging and instrumentation.
Input Referred Noise0.09 LSB rms (with 2.5 V reference) - contributes <0.02% RMS noise floor relative to full-scale, critical for low-amplitude signal capture.
Integral Nonlinearity±0.5 LSB max - limits end-point error to ±0.012% of full scale, preserving accuracy in calibration-critical systems.
Power Consumption254 mW typical (59 mW for AD9221, 100 mW for AD9223) - scales with speed, allowing thermal-aware selection within same footprint.
Reference OptionsInternal 1 V or 2.5 V (±35 mV tolerance), or external reference via VREF/REFCOM - enables trade-off between simplicity and dc drift control.

Pinout & Package

AD9220ARS-REEL is housed in a 28-lead SSOP (RS-28) package with 0.635 mm lead pitch and exposed pad for thermal management. Pin compatibility across AD9221/AD9223/AD9220 allows drop-in speed upgrades without layout change.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
CLKClock InputSingle-ended CMOS/TTL-compatible input controlling all conversion timing; rising edge triggers sampling.
VINA / VINBDifferential Analog InputsAccepts true differential or single-ended signals; core input is VINA – VINB, bounded by ±VREF.
VREF / REFCOMReference I/O PairVREF sets full-scale range (1 V or 2.5 V); REFCOM is reference return - must be tied to AVSS if using internal reference.
SENSEReference Mode SelectHigh = 2.5 V internal reference; low = 1 V internal reference - configures gain and noise performance.
BIT 1 (MSB) to BIT 12 (LSB)Parallel Digital OutputsStraight-binary format, 3-state capable; compatible with 3.3 V or 5 V logic families depending on DVDD setting.
OTROut-of-Range IndicatorActive-high flag synchronized to MSB; distinguishes positive overflow (MSB=1, OTR=1) from negative overflow (MSB=0, OTR=1).
CAPB / CAPTNoise Reduction TerminalsConnect 0.1 µF ceramic capacitors to AVSS to stabilize internal reference and reduce high-frequency noise.
CMLCommon-Mode LevelBias point for differential input stage; typically tied to AVDD/2 (2.5 V) to optimize THD and SNR.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Monolithic 12-bit ADC with integrated SHA and referenceEliminates need for external sample-hold, reference buffer, or trimming components - reduces BOM count and board area in compact DAQ modules.
Flexible input configuration (single-ended/differential, 2 V or 5 V span)Supports direct connection to op-amp drivers, transformer-coupled IF stages, or DC-coupled sensors without level-shifting circuitry.
Low aperture jitter (4 ps rms)Enables >10-bit ENOB at multi-MHz input frequencies - essential for direct IF sampling in communications receivers.
3-cycle pipeline latency with deterministic timingAllows precise time-of-arrival alignment in synchronized multi-channel systems using common clock distribution.
Pin-compatible family (AD9221/AD9223/AD9220)Permits design reuse across performance tiers: replace AD9220ARS-REEL with AD9223ARS-REEL for lower power at 3 MSPS without PCB revision.

Applications

Medical Ultrasound Beamforming Industrial Process Monitoring

Use Scenario: Digitizing echo return signals from phased-array transducers at 5–10 MSPS with 12-bit resolution for real-time beam synthesis.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Primary ADC capturing RF envelope or baseband I/Q data; CLK synchronized to ultrasound pulse repetition interval.

Use Value: 88 dB SFDR suppresses harmonic artifacts from tissue interfaces; 0.09 LSB noise preserves weak echo contrast in deep-tissue imaging.

Use Scenario: High-accuracy voltage/current monitoring in PLC analog input modules with cold-junction compensation and sensor linearization.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Precision front-end ADC interfacing with low-drift instrumentation amplifiers; operates in continuous conversion mode with DMA-triggered reads.

Use Value: ±0.5 LSB INL ensures <0.012% full-scale error over temperature; internal 2.5 V reference eliminates external reference drift dependency.

Communications Direct-IF Receiver Test & Measurement Digitizers

Use Scenario: Downconverting and digitizing 2–5 MHz IF signals in software-defined radio (SDR) receivers without analog filtering prior to ADC.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Wideband ADC with differential input configured for AC-coupled IF; CML biased at 2.5 V to maximize SFDR beyond Nyquist.

Use Value: 60 MHz small-signal bandwidth and 4 ps aperture jitter enable clean digitization of 4.5 MHz signals with >11-bit ENOB at –0.5 dBFS.

Use Scenario: Modular digitizer card capturing transient waveforms (e.g., switch-mode power supply ripple, motor startup surges) at 10 MSPS with post-processing FFT analysis.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: High-speed acquisition engine with OTR flag enabling automatic gain ranging and overflow recovery in firmware.

Use Value: Straight-binary output simplifies FPGA interface logic; 28-pin SSOP fits dense card layouts while maintaining thermal headroom at 254 mW.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ar 12-bit, 10 MSPS ADC appl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
AD9220AR-REELSame electrical specs and pinout, but in 28-lead SOIC (R-28) instead of SSOP (RS-28); higher θJA (71.4°C/W vs. 63.3°C/W).Preferred for through-hole prototyping or legacy SOIC footprints; less suitable for high-density SMT layouts.Select AD9220AR-REEL only when board assembly process or mechanical constraints require SOIC packaging.
ADS8325IPFBT16-bit, 100 kSPS SAR ADC (TI); no pipeline latency, lower power (15 mW), but 100× slower sampling rate and no integrated SHA.Used in high-resolution, low-speed applications like precision sensor readout - not viable for real-time 10 MSPS streaming.Choose ADS8325IPFBT only when resolution >12 bits and speed <100 kSPS suffice; not a functional replacement for AD9220ARS-REEL.

Compared with AD9220AR-REEL, AD9220ARS-REEL offers superior thermal performance in space-constrained layouts, while ADS8325IPFBT trades speed and integration for resolution - making AD9220ARS-REEL the sole fit for 10 MSPS, 12-bit, monolithic ADC requirements with integrated reference and SHA.

FAQ

What is the maximum sampling rate supported by the AD9220ARS-REEL?

The AD9220ARS-REEL supports a maximum conversion rate of 10.0 MSPS, as specified in the Rev. E datasheet under AC Specifications. This rate is guaranteed across the full industrial temperature range (–40°C to +85°C) with AVDD = 5 V, DVDD = 5 V, and VREF = 2.5 V. The minimum clock period is 100 ns, corresponding to a 10 MHz clock frequency.

Does the AD9220ARS-REEL require an external reference voltage?

No, the AD9220ARS-REEL includes a programmable internal voltage reference with two selectable outputs: 1 V or 2.5 V, configured via the SENSE pin. External reference operation is optional and supported via the VREF and REFCOM pins, but not required - the internal reference delivers ±35 mV tolerance at 2.5 V mode and enables full functionality of AD9220ARS-REEL out-of-the-box.

How does the OTR (Out-of-Range) signal function in the AD9220ARS-REEL?

The OTR signal in AD9220ARS-REEL is an active-high, synchronous flag indicating analog input overflow. When OTR = 1, the input exceeded ±VREF range: if BIT 1 (MSB) = 1, it indicates positive overflow; if BIT 1 = 0, it indicates negative overflow. This dual-signal encoding allows unambiguous detection of over/underflow conditions without additional logic, directly supporting auto-ranging firmware in AD9220ARS-REEL-based systems.

Can the AD9220ARS-REEL operate with a 3.3 V digital supply?

Yes, the AD9220ARS-REEL supports DVDD from 2.7 V to 5.25 V, including standard 3.3 V logic levels. Its digital outputs are fully compatible with 3.3 V CMOS/TTL families when DVDD = 3.3 V, delivering VOH ≥ 2.80 V (IOH = 0.5 mA) and VOL ≤ 0.4 V (IOL = 1.6 mA). This allows seamless interfacing with FPGAs and microcontrollers operating at 3.3 V without level shifters.

What is the thermal resistance (θJA) of the AD9220ARS-REEL package?

The AD9220ARS-REEL uses a 28-lead SSOP (RS-28) package with a junction-to-ambient thermal resistance (θJA) of 63.3°C/W, as documented in the Thermal Characteristics section of the Rev. E datasheet. This value assumes standard JEDEC 2-layer board conditions and is 8.1°C/W lower than the SOIC variant (θJA = 71.4°C/W), reflecting improved heat dissipation in the SSOP footprint - critical for sustained 254 mW operation in compact enclosures.
